Best Time to Visit Oman by Season

Located in the Southeastern quarter of the Arabian Peninsula, Oman experiences warm temperatures throughout the year. The period from December to February is considered the winter months and is also the busiest time of the year for tourists. Expect some heavy but short spells of rain during January and February. March and April usher in springtime weather with flower-filled mountainsides and temperatures around 95°F. Summers in Oman are scorching with temperatures during the months of May-August reaching 100°F and more. During this time, the southern part of Oman experiences the Khareef or monsoon season, which brings down the temperature and increases humidity levels. It’s a busy season in the region as locals head to the beaches of Salalah. The autumn months of September, October, and November see temperatures cooling a little. This is considered to be the shoulder season for travel in Oman.

The mountains of Oman see cooler temperatures all through the year. During the winter months, average daytime highs are around 68°F, and nighttime temperatures can fall to 50°F. Even during the summer months, daytime temperatures rarely push past 85°F.

What to Pack for Oman

For a country that experiences warm day time temperatures year-round, it’s best to pack clothes made from breathable fabrics such as cotton and linen. We strongly recommend that you dress modestly in tops that cover your shoulders and upper arms, and dresses that reach your knees. Long dresses work particularly well for the climate and dress code in the country. Women should wear long-sleeved shirts and pants that cover the ankles while visiting places of worship, avoid sheer fabrics, and cover their heads with a scarf or shawl. For men, we recommend linen trousers, shorts that cover the knees, and lightweight shirts. A sun hat, sunscreen, and sunglasses are, of course, a must.

While visitors can wear tank tops, shorts, and swimsuits to their hotel’s pool or at a private beach, modest dressing is recommended at public beaches and when swimming in wadis. Women can wear a T-shirt over their swimwear while men can wear Bermuda style swim shorts.

Nights in the desert and mountainous regions can get cold, so pack a sweater, jumper or light jacket. If you are planning on visiting the mountains, get a good pair of walking or hiking shoes as the terrain is rugged.
